>> driven by bug 1960, I have been doing some work on quilt in OE,
>> refactoring, cleaning up and adding version 0.46.  In the process I also
>> dropped version version 0.39.  Is there anybody that needs this
>> particular version or can I commit to drop it?  I grepped through OE and
>> found no reference to it.  If you want it kept, speak up now.

> What are your good reasons to drop it? I see no point in removing stuff
> just to boost someones commit stats under the moniker "clean up"

  I would like to second this (following my always-conservative
attitude to dropping stuff (without good reason) on which someone
worked hard previously (and someone can in the future)).

  To elaborate, I hope that we'll revamp OE support for using external
toolchains for building single packages, because it seems that people
have got a stereotype that OE is for building entire system from
scratch (at that would be too limiting - why I'd use top-notch
solution to build a whole distro while revert to using adhoc tools to
build packages for 3rd-party systems?)

  For example, I just pushed openwrt-sdk distro config, which allows
to build packages against OpenWRT SDK. Due to OpenWRT dependencies, it
may be required to build older than the latest versions of some
packages.
